A four-time Dora Mavor Moore Award winner, Natasha Poon Woo is a distinguished performer and director who served as the Associate Artistic Director of Canadian Contemporary Dance Theatre. A summa cum laude graduate of SUNY Purchase and an Endorsed Expert Teacher by the Limón Foundation, she has taught for the National Ballet of Canada and Toronto Metropolitan University. She currently performs with elite companies including Côté Danse and Rock Bottom Movement.
12:00pm | C-I Training™: Developed by Dr. Donna Krasnow, this system combines conditioning for strength and flexibility with visualization for neuromuscular re-patterning and mind-body integration. Please bring a mat.
1:30pm | Limón Technique: Explore the principles of breath, suspension, and fall and recovery through floor work, centre exercises, and travelling phrases inspired by the José Limón repertoire. This syllabus follows the lineage of master educators Donna Krasnow and Daniel Lewis. Bare feet or socks recommended.
